@StarStruck because all your notes have ".onenote" Format which is unique to onenote and it is hard to migrate to other apps.

".md" Migration, however, is effortless, because it is a universal format. You just open your files with other app and 99% will be the same. Your won't have a similar seamless transition with onenote, so sustainability here is, really, uncomparable here

Check out this site --> https://philosopher.life/

Software: TiddlyWiki

It is a note taking software in which notes stored in it are save in a single html file making it really portable.
